The Scorpion King 2: Rise of a Warrior is the second installment in The Scorpion King film series, serving as a direct-to-DVD prequel to the 2002 film The Scorpion King . The movie was a U.S.-German-South African co-production, filmed on location in South Africa and Namibia with a reduced budget compared to its predecessor. Directed by Russell Mulcahy (known for Highlander and The Shadow ), the film aims to explore the origin story of Mathayus, the heroic figure who would later become the legendary Scorpion King. It introduces a younger Mathayus, played by Michael Copon, and follows his journey from a vengeful son to a formidable warrior.

Critically, The Scorpion King 2 faced challenges. Reviewers often pointed out that the visual effects and budget constraints were highly visible compared to the big-budget 2002 original. Michael Copon faced the heavy task of filling Dwayne Johnson’s shoes, which drew mixed reactions.
Indian audiences have a deep-seated nostalgia for The Mummy cinematic universe. Because the original Scorpion King was a staple on Indian satellite television networks (like Sony Max and Star Gold) throughout the 2000s and 2010s, audiences frequently seek out the sequels and prequels online to complete the saga. 3.
